“Britain’s Daily Mail & General Trust PLC said Friday it has acquired cultural news website Elite Daily, which bills itself as ‘the voice of Generation Y,’ under a plan to broaden the U.K. publisher’s footprint in the U.S.
The deal price was $47 million, a person familiar with the situation said.
Elite Daily, which had 33.3 million unique U.S. visitors in December, according to analytics firm comScoreInc., will join forces with the tabloid newspaper’s fast-growing U.S. website, DailyMail.com, which focuses on traditional breaking news and celebrity stories.”
